Output d26cbc1b32d2be4fb12bb01d754118428ec5496d41fcbee6aa0d8ff874c8e887:1

value
682221310
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74765ab256bfd960ede5e427d132f60ed385f31b OP_EQUAL
address
MJWxQ5jAbKQBgHKBcPhQFCU6FiA2npFC6R
transaction
d26cbc1b32d2be4fb12bb01d754118428ec5496d41fcbee6aa0d8ff874c8e887
spent
true